Subject: FleetSum fuel-usage report — January build

Welcome aboard. This release recalculates per-vehicle fuel averages using odometer deltas rather than pump logs, so historical figures will shift slightly. Please review the Millbrae depot sample before wider distribution and note any anomalies in the tracker. For reference, every report run is stamped with the build token shown below.

pipeline stamp: htk9_ce63042d9

Management Meeting Minutes — Reseller Programme

Present: Dena Forsgate, Ollie Rennick, Priya Calloway.

Quick recap: the Fernlight reseller programme is tracking ahead of plan — 14 partners signed versus the 10 we'd hoped for. Margins are a bit thinner than modelled, mostly down to the tiered discount we offered early joiners. Ollie will tighten the discount bands before the next intake. Where we want to take the programme next is covered in the note below.

board note of yahip-tadug: Headcount on the Zorath team goes from 9 to 100 by the end of April. Gross margin on Zorath came in at 10 percent against a plan of 20 percent.

Handover: Ledger schema migration (zero downtime)

Handing this to support before I'm out next week. The Quillbase ledger migration uses the expand-contract pattern: new columns are live, dual writes are enabled, and the backfill job runs nightly. Nothing should page unless dual-write lag exceeds five minutes. If customers report mismatched balances, check the backfill status first. The migration service is currently running with these settings.

config for kafof-bawef:
holath:
  log_level: debug
  metrics_host: metrics.holath.qorvelsys.internal
  pin: 2191
  pool_size: 32

Quarterly Planning Note — Merrow Series Pricing

Sales leads: for Q2 we are holding list prices on the Merrow Series but tightening discount authority. Standard discounts cap at 12%; anything beyond requires regional approval with a margin worksheet attached. Bundled offers with the Calder add-on remain available but must be quoted as a package, not line-itemed. Win-rate data suggests we have been underpricing mid-tier deals. One further point is confidential.

board note of tadup-tajog: Headcount on the Oliiel team goes from 31 to 88 by the end of February. Gross margin on Oliiel came in at 62 percent against a plan of 29 percent.